This page uses published market research from the Art Basel and UBS Art Market Report, alongside national arts-economy figures from the National Endowment for the Arts and the U.S. Bureau of Economic Analysis. Every statistic above links to its named source and includes the reporting period.

Market reports describe the broader landscape, not the value or future performance of any individual artwork. Collectors should use them as context, then spend time with the work itself.
